What to Look for in a Robot Vacuum and Mop
Before diving into the leading picks, it’s important to understand the essential features to consider when picking a robot vacuum and mop:
Suction Power: The suction power figures out how successfully the robot can select up dirt and particles. Search for designs with at least 2000Pa of suction power for optimal performance.Battery Life: A longer battery life means the robot can clean bigger locations without needing to charge. Go for a battery that lasts at least 1.5 to 2 hours.Navigation Technology: Advanced navigation systems, such as L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or VSLAM (Vis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ping), make sure the robot can map your home properly and prevent barriers.Cleaning Modes: Different cleaning modes, such as edge cleaning, area cleaning, and scheduled cleaning, offer versatility and performance.App Integration: An easy to use app allows you to manage the robot, set cleaning schedules, and monitor its efficiency from your smart device.Tank Capacity: Larger dust and water tanks reduce the frequency of clearing and refilling, making the cleaning process more hassle-free.Noise Level: Opt for models with low noise levels to prevent interrupting your everyday activities.Customer Support: Reliable customer support is essential in case you encounter any issues or have questions.Top Picks for the Best Robot Vacuum and Mop UK

Q1: Are robot vacuums and mops ideal for homes with pets?
A1: Yes, lots of robot vacuums and mops are created to manage pet hair and dander successfully. Search for designs with strong suction power and specialized pet cleaning modes.
Q2: Can robot vacuums and mops clean all kinds of floorings?
A2: Most robot vacuums and mops are versatile and can clean up numerous floor types, consisting of wood, tile, and carpet. Nevertheless, some models may perform better on specific surface areas. Check the manufacturer’s specs for the very best results.
Q3: How typically should I clean the robot vacuum and mop?
A3: It’s recommended to empty the dustbin and clean the filters after each usage. The water tank and mopping pads must be cleaned up and changed regularly to keep health and performance.
Q4: Can I manage the robot vacuum and mop with voice commands?
A4: Yes, many models work with sm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, allowing you to control them with voice commands.
Q5: Are robot vacuums and mops energy-efficient?
A5: Generally, robot vacuums and mops are developed to be energy-efficient, with most models using less power than traditional vacuum. Nevertheless, battery life and energy intake can vary between models.
